Transaction 2cc60b152f99080c5a2289a1ec021d53d93e7a0950b6af643d772af5c5eac71f
1 Input
1 Output
-
2cc60b152f99080c5a2289a1ec021d53d93e7a0950b6af643d772af5c5eac71f:0
- value
- 3000308
- script pubkey
- OP_0 OP_PUSHBYTES_20 1c46b4367e20e81ae6a0053b74fec3967f8682a8
- address
- bc1qr3rtgdn7yr5p4e4qq5ahflkrjelcdq4g406luk